How many times do they say inconceivable in The Princess Bride?

"As you wish" is said seven times (four by Westley, three by the grandfather). "Inconceivable" is said five times. And the famous line "My name is Inigo Montoya" is said six times.

Why does Wesley say as you wish?

It's a statement of honor, of cherishing, of commitment — of saying, “I'm yours, and everything I have is yours. As the book's author (through the grandfather) confirms early in the film, when Westley says “as you wish” to Buttercup he is really saying “I love you.”

What is a fire swamp?

The fire swamp is an uninviting location with three primary dangers: flame spurts, lightning sand, and rodents of unusual size (R.O.U.S.).

Is the princess bride funny?

Of all the fans who have professed undying love for “The Princess Bride,” there's one star Cary Elwes never expected to hear from: Pope John Paul II. Elwes briefly met His Holiness at the Vatican in 1988, a year after the movie was released. “Very good film. Very funny,” the pope said.

What is have fun storming the castle line?

This famous line is spoken by Miracle Max, played by Billy Crystal, in The PrincessBride (directed by Rob Reiner, 1987). Miracle Max and his wife send them off with the cheery good-bye, "Have fun storming the castle!"
